The order you mix in matters

On a multi-part feed schedule, order is not a detail. Get it wrong and you see flocs in your reservoir and measure an EC lower than you dosed, because part of your feed has precipitated and is no longer available.

The rule behind every schedule is the same: concentrates must never meet each other undiluted. Each product goes into the water separately, and the water does the diluting.

A workable order:

  1. Start with your reservoir filled with water, not an empty tank you pour everything into.
  2. Add one component at a time and stir until fully dissolved before the next goes in.
  3. Keep calcium away from sulphate and phosphate. That is the combination that precipitates most often. If your schedule has a separate calcium component, give it space between the rest.
  4. Only measure EC once everything has dissolved and the solution has been stirred through.
  5. Set pH last. Adding nutrient shifts pH, so doing it the other way round means doing it twice.

Frequently asked questions

Do I really need to pre-dilute?
Not always, but it helps. Pre-diluting makes the chance of two concentrates meeting undiluted close to zero.

There are flocs in my solution.
That is almost always a precipitate from two components added too closely together. Work more slowly and stir in between.
